- download any images on web using various methods.
- downloaded Images are saved into folder in app.
- preview thumbnails and slide show.
- image filtering by linked or not, image size(L/M/S)
- auto searching numbered images. ex) 001.jpg, 002.jpg
- sorting by image size.
- enable to download only selected images.
- easy to marge multiple folders.
- copy images to the camera roll.
- Xscreen compatible.
- dark mode supported.
- use Ad blocking for free.
- convert images to PDF file.
- Retina display supported.
- Modern and non-noisy design.

Good, but awkward to use
Puts images from one page into one folder. You can merge folders, but get an error if you try to merge folders that have already been merged. And to move images to the camera roll or other folder, you have to select each image individually. There sold be a select all so you can move whole folders
